Abstract

A method for the production of an elastic composite material with a textile surface. First, a laminate is produced, which has elastic cover layers and a core composed of a nonwoven fabric. Subsequently, the laminate is separated into two strips, each of which has a cover layer and an adhering layer of nonwoven fabric, by tearing open the core.

Claims (9)

1. A method for the production of an elastic composite material with a textile surface, comprising:

producing a laminate that has elastic cover layers and a core composed of a nonwoven fabric, and

subsequently separating the laminate into two strips, each strip having a cover layer and an adhering layer of nonwoven fabric, by tearing open the core;

wherein the core comprises a multi-layer nonwoven fabric with an SMS layer structure, which fabric has outer layers composed of a spun-bonded nonwoven fabric (S) and a center nonwoven layer composed of melt-blown fibers (M).

2. The method according to claim 1 , wherein the step of separating comprises grasping the strips separately and pulling them apart by applying tensile forces.

3. The method according to claim 1 , wherein the strips are passed over driven rollers and wound up separately.

4. The method according to claim 1 , wherein the step of tearing open the core is supported by a blade disposed in a parting plane.

5. The method according to claim 1 , wherein the core is formed of a nonwoven fabric web, which is laminated in between the elastic cover layers which are formed of elastic film webs.

6. The method according to claim 5 , wherein the nonwoven fabric web and the elastic film webs are glued together.
